Boxing best of Commonwealth

Taha Ahmad (left) will be one of eight Australian boxers, including Tina Rahimi and Alex Winwood, who will be marking their debut at the Commonwealth Games later this year.

REGENTS Park boxer Taha Ahmad will be donning the green and gold when he makes his Commonwealth Games debut at the Birmingham 2022 Commonwealth Games later this year.

The 21-year-old is part of the 11-strong boxing team and will be taking on the best in the Commonwealth in the 71kg class.
Boxing Australia General Manager Dinah Glykidis congratulated Taha and the other boxers on their selection, saying they “are ready to test themselves against the best fighters across the Commonwealth”.
“Boxing Australia athletes provided many thrills at the 2018 Commonwealth Games on the Gold Coast, and I’m sure our 11 boxers are ready to represent the green and gold in Birmingham,” she said.
“We commend the hard work each of the 11 fighters have put in to get to this moment, we are so proud of each of them.
“We know they will continue practising and improving over the next few months and we can’t wait to see them compete at the Games.”
The Birmingham 2022 Commonwealth Games will be held from Thursday, July 28 to Monday, August 8, with the boxing from Friday, July 29 to Sunday, August 7.
